                              • D Offline
                                discostur
                                last edited by

                                I had the same problem as @csi-laser - it was related due to no default storage SR in the cluster. I have a two node cluster with only local storage - no shared storage configured.

                                I added the SR UUID to the xe import command in the script an then the deploy worked!

                                      • olivierlambertO Offline
                                        olivierlambert Vates 🪐 Co-Founder CEO
                                        last edited by

                                        You need to set a default sr with this command:

                                        xe pool-param-set uuid=<pool-uuid> default-SR=<sr-uuid>
